#538cbc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#538cbc is composed of 32.5% red, 54.9%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.9% cyan, 25.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 207.4 degrees, a saturation of 43.9% and a lightness of 53.1%. #538cbc color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ffff with #001979.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#538cbc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#538cbc has RGB values of R:83, G:140,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 5475516.
